Built
Built Built, n. Shape; build; form of structure; as, the built of a ship. [Obs.] --Dryden.
Built
Built Built, a. Formed; shaped; constructed; made; -- often used in composition and preceded by the word denoting the form; as, frigate-built, clipper-built, etc. Like the generality of Genoese countrywomen, strongly built. --Landor.
